There is a new sports team in town!  The Rocky Mountain Riot is a co-ed, banked track roller derby team.  We were contacted by them a couple of weeks ago and asked to help out with a fundraiser.  My brother in law is on the team, so I figured why not.  Not to mention the fact that we like roller derby anyway.  So we donated a bunch of keychains and cellphone charms to put in goody bags that were handed out at the event today, and a square stainless steel Gridlock byzantine bracelet that went in silent auction.

Because I can’t do anything the easy way, I also decided to make a new top, that Jenn ended up sporting.  It was a beautiful day for it.

We also brought a few of our glow in the dark chainmaille hacky sacks, which were a hit.  There was lots of food, 5 live bands, and a good time for all.
